A two component-type developer for electrophotography showing improved electrophotographic performances and also free from carrier adhesion (undesirable carrier transfer to the photosensitive member and recording materials) is constituted by using a magnetic carrier of 5-100 mu m in particle size. The carrier has a bulk density of at most 30 g/cm3, and magnetic properties including: a magnetization of 30-150 emu/cm3 under a magnetic field strength of 1000 oersted, a magnetization (residual magnetization sigma r) of at least 25 emu/cm3 under a magnetic field strength of zero oersted, a coercive force of less than 300 oersted, and a relationship of:| sigma 1000- sigma 300|/ sigma 1000</=0.40wherein sigma 1000 and sigma 300 denote magnetizations under magnetic field strength of 1000 oersted and 300 oersted, respectively. |
